的 分钟 ()函数数组返回最低的元素,或最低在两个或更多的逗号分隔的参数。
min ( array $values ) : mixed
要么
min ( mixed $value1 [, mixed $... ] ) : mixed
序号 | 参数及说明 |
---|---|
1 | 值 如果仅给出一个参数,则它应该是一组值可以相同或不同的值 |
2 | value1,value2,.. 如果给出两个或多个参数,则它们应该是相同或不同类型的任何可比较值 |
PHPmin()
函数从数组参数或值序列中返回最小值。标准比较运算符适用。如果不同类型的多个值相等(例如0和'PHP'),则将返回该函数的第一个参数。
此功能在PHP 4.x,PHP 5.x和PHP 7.x中可用。
以下示例从数字数组返回最小值。
<?php $arg=array(23, 5.55, 142, 56, 99); echo "array="; foreach ($arg as $i) echo $i . ","; echo "\n"; echo "min = " . min($arg); ?>
输出结果
这将产生以下结果-
array=23,5.55,142,56,99, min = 5.55
以下示例min()
从字符串数组返回。-
<?php $arg=array("Java", "Angular", "PHP", "C", "Kotlin"); echo "array="; foreach ($arg as $i) echo $i . ","; echo "\n"; echo "min = " . min($arg); ?>
输出结果
这将产生以下结果-
array=Java,Angular,PHP,C,Kotlin, min = Angular
min()
在下面的示例中,提供了一系列字符串值以起作用。
<?php $val1="Java"; $val2="Angular"; $val3="PHP"; $val4="C"; $val5="Kotlin"; echo "values=" . $val1 . "," . $val2 . "," . $val3 . "," . $val4 . "," . $val5 . "\n"; echo "min = " . min($val1, $val2, $val3,$val4,$val5); ?>
输出结果
这将产生以下结果-
values=Java,Angular,PHP,C,Kotlin min = Angular
在以下示例数组中是混合数据类型的集合-
<?php $arg=array(23, "Java", 142, 1e2, 99); echo "array="; foreach ($arg as $i) echo $i . ","; echo "\n"; echo "min = " . min($arg); ?>
输出结果
这将产生以下结果-
array=23,Java,142,100,99, min = Java